Subject: FX hedging call for the Veldran rollout

Hi all,

Quick heads-up before the sales leads start quoting in the Meridas region: we've decided to hedge roughly 70% of expected Veldran receipts for the next two quarters. Tomas ran the numbers and the premium is worth the sleep we'll get. Pricing sheets update Friday. Before you share anything externally, read the note below carefully.

internal memo for yahag-hahig: Belwynix Group plans to lower the Silir list price by 62 percent in May.

## Formula sandbox tuning

User-supplied formulas in Gridmoor execute inside a restricted interpreter with hard ceilings on time, memory, and call depth. Reviewers should confirm any change to these ceilings is justified in the PR description, since raising them widens the abuse surface. Defaults were chosen from production traces. The current limits are as follows.

limits module of tafog-fawip:
WEIGHTS = {
    "julix": 57,
    "lamys": 992,
    "kasvan": 209,
    "quenok": 750,
    "alddor": 259,
    "oliath": 1009,
    "wenix": 815,
}

Brambledash sends batch email digests on a schedule controlled entirely by environment variables, so the release manager should verify these before each cut:

- `DIGEST_CRON` — cron expression for the batch window (default: nightly)
- `DIGEST_BATCH_SIZE` — recipients per batch, keep under 500
- `DIGEST_TIMEZONE` — affects subject-line dates only

A misconfigured schedule can double-send digests, so changes require a staging dry run first. The outbound mail relay also requires a credential, which is set on the line immediately below.

vault entry, bagep-yahip: VAULT_KEY8=d2a227e5